What's Happening?
C.J. Gardner-Johnson, a safety known for his dynamic play and strong personality, has been released by the Houston Texans. This decision comes after Gardner-Johnson's brief tenure with the team, which began when he was acquired from the Philadelphia Eagles in March. Reports suggest that friction between Gardner-Johnson and the Texans, particularly regarding his role and desire to blitz more, contributed to his release. Gardner-Johnson played in only three games for the Texans before hitting the open market. His release has sparked discussions about potential teams that might benefit from his skills, including the New York Jets, Dallas Cowboys, and Kansas City Chiefs.
